Understanding Drainage Gullies: Square Gullies, Circular Gullies, Road Gullies and Anti-Flood Solutions

Learning About Drainage Gullies and Their Role in Modern Drainage Systems




Surface water systems use a variety of elements that direct water efficiently away from structures, roads and external surfaces.
Among these components, drainage gullies are important for capturing surface water and directing it into subsurface pipework.




A drainage gully is positioned at surface level and functions as a gathering point for rainwater, wastewater or surface runoff from paved areas.
By directing water into the drainage network, gullies reduce standing water, shield structures from moisture issues and reduce the likelihood of localised flooding.




Gullies are widely used in domestic driveways, patios, commercial premises and public infrastructure.
Different environments require different designs, which is why several types are available, including square gullies, round gullies, road gullies and specialised anti flood gullies.
Knowing how these options operate can help property owners and contractors choose the appropriate solution.



Types of Drainage Gullies



Square Gullies




Square gullies are frequently used in domestic drainage installations.
Their design allows them to sit neatly within paved surfaces such as patios, driveways and garden pathways.




One benefit of square gullies is the ease with which grates can be integrated with surrounding paving slabs or block paving.
This makes installation simple while maintaining a tidy and organised layout.




Square gullies often include a lift-out grid and a sediment bucket.
The bucket captures debris such as leaves, grit and dirt before it reaches the drainage pipework.




This reduces the risk of blockages and keeps routine cleaning manageable.
They are often chosen where both function and efficient installation are required, particularly in residential drainage systems.



Round Gullies




Round gullies are another widely used option for managing surface water.
Their rounded design allows water to move easily into the drainage system and can be effective in areas with continuous runoff.




Round gullies are often installed in gardens, landscaping projects and compact paved areas.
Their shape also allows them to connect easily with circular drainage pipes.




In many installations, round gullies include a trap that prevents unwanted odours from travelling back through the pipe system.
This makes them suitable for drainage linked with household waste outlets as well as surface water.




Because of their straightforward structure and reliable flow characteristics, round gullies remain a regular choice for many residential drainage setups.



Road Gullies




Road gullies are built for public infrastructure such as streets, car parks and industrial sites.
These gullies capture large volumes of rainwater from roads and carry it into underground drainage networks.




Unlike smaller domestic gullies, road gullies are constructed to handle heavy traffic and demanding conditions.
They usually include durable grates or covers made from materials able to support vehicle loads.




Road gullies also contain deeper sediment traps.
These traps collect debris such as gravel, leaves and road grit more info before it reaches the drainage pipes.




This supports flow capacity and reduces maintenance within the wider drainage system.
Correctly installed road gullies are important for avoiding water accumulation on roads, which can otherwise cause surface damage or dangerous driving conditions.



Anti Flood Gully Solutions




A Murray anti flood gully is designed to prevent water from backing up through the drainage system during intense rainfall or sewer surcharge.




When drainage networks become overwhelmed, water can sometimes reverse flow through pipework.
Anti flood gullies reduce this issue by including features that prevent reverse flow while still allowing regular water flow.




The Murray design is often installed in areas that face occasional drainage surges.
By preventing backflow at ground level, these gullies offer a reliable level of protection for properties connected to shared drainage systems.



Understanding Anti Flood Gully Systems




An anti flood gully operates by allowing water to flow in a single direction.
This type of system is especially useful in locations where heavy rainfall, high groundwater levels or pressurised sewer systems can create pressure within the drainage network.




In domestic settings, anti flood gullies can be fitted near external waste outlets, patios or low-lying drainage points.
Their design limits the risk of water coming up through ground-level drains during severe weather.




For homeowners who have previously experienced drainage surcharges or flooding from click here drains, installing an anti flood gully can offer reassurance.



Selecting a Suitable Drainage Gully




Choosing the appropriate drainage gully depends on several factors, including the location, expected water flow and the type of surface where it will be installed.




Domestic patios and driveways often benefit from square or round gullies that integrate easily with paving.
Areas exposed to heavier water runoff may need deeper traps or wider outlets to support effective drainage.




Public spaces and roads demand durable road gullies capable of supporting vehicle traffic while managing high water volumes.
Where flood risk or backflow is a concern, anti flood options such as the Murray anti flood gully offer extra protection.




Correct installation and routine maintenance are also necessary considerations.
Even well designed drainage systems need periodic inspection and cleaning to ensure that sediment traps and buckets remain clear.



FAQs About Drainage Gullies



What is the purpose of a drainage gully?



A drainage gully collects surface water and channels it into underground pipework while collecting debris that could otherwise block the system.



Where are square gullies most commonly used?



Square gullies are usually installed in patios, driveways and paved garden areas where their shape aligns well with paving materials.



How do round gullies compare with square gullies?



Round gullies link directly with circular pipe systems and allow water to flow smoothly into the drainage network.



Why are road gullies deeper than domestic gullies?



Road gullies include larger sediment traps designed to handle debris such as grit, gravel and leaves often found on roads.



What makes an anti flood gully different from a standard gully?



Anti flood gullies include features that prevent water flowing backwards through the drain during heavy rainfall or sewer overload.



When should a Murray anti flood gully be installed?



It is often installed in areas where backflow has previously occurred or where drainage systems may become overwhelmed during intense rainfall.



Do drainage gullies require maintenance?



Yes. Periodic removal of debris from sediment buckets and grids helps ensure water flowing freely through the system.
